Xoom Wireless Inc 82028826 Store in Oklahoma City June 21, 2021 | Categories: Filter: Address 4340 Northwest 39th StreetOklahoma City, OK 73112Contact Tel.: 4056034700Email: xoomwirelessok@gmail.com